Output 43d7efb7d3070d8df9c48abd5f829f4f67b1b78a24dd2671d63d03266716b49a:1

value
20453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4cff9a7846ae59424cbb081a1ea8a3b76a7cbdb OP_EQUAL
address
3NYs8enB5kRBp2UUnbuPFd7GCcYka2MFdx
transaction
43d7efb7d3070d8df9c48abd5f829f4f67b1b78a24dd2671d63d03266716b49a
spent
true